Yes I know who Martha and John King are although I haven't personally met them.

They provide training courses for the FAA certificates and ratings. I have used their Video home study courses for the FAA CPL and IR. Also have the Multi Engine Flying Video course.

With their videos and dvd's they provide tuition to many of the pilots over in the States... around 50% if I remember correctly.
